Action item from the Mirewater tide-table widget incident. Owner: release manager. Widget cached stale harbor offsets after the DST change, showing tides six hours off for two days. Required: add a cache-invalidation check to the release checklist, block deploys when offset tables are older than 24 hours, and verify the Saltgate harbor feed before each cut. Deadline: next release. Checklist template and sign-off procedure are documented on the internal page below.

wiki page, kawif-bajep: https://artifactory.zarqelforge.internal/issue/browse/display/display/projects/spaces/secrets/000fe6ec5a46af29355003e1

**Handover — Pinnock thumbnail queue**

For the incoming contractor: the Marrowvale thumbnail queue is mine until Friday, then yours. Workers autoscale; broker does not. Watch the dead-letter queue after deploys — it fills fast if the resize binary segfaults. Runbook is in the team wiki under Pinnock. Everything you need to stand up a local worker is in the block below.

service settings:
PRAIX_LOG_LEVEL=error
PRAIX_METRICS_HOST=metrics.praix.qorvelcorp.corp
PRAIX_POOL_SIZE=16

Subject: Handover — Squatrap release duties

Hey Marisol,

Taking over Squatrap (the typo-squatting package scanner) releases while Devin's out. Pipeline's in good shape — just review the ruleset diff before tagging, and double-check the lexical-distance thresholds didn't drift. Publish goes through the usual signed channel; the registry rejects anything unsigned. For your review, the signing key the pipeline currently uses is pasted below.

deploy key for kajof-fajop: bky6_gDHw9Q

Meeting notes — Dispatch desk briefing, Thursday session

Attendees reviewed the transfer of the notarised deed for the Calderwick property acquisition. The notary at Pellam & Rourke confirmed the document is sealed and ready for collection. Dispatch will arrange a dedicated run rather than bundling it with routine mail, given the original cannot be replaced. The desk will hold the sealed envelope in the locked cabinet until the courier arrives.

The confidential hand-over instruction appears immediately below these notes.

courier memo of tawep-tajep: the quenius ulaiel courier leaves the fenir ledger at gate 9128 under passcode 527513